NHL Player Props Picks for Saturday, February 18th 2023

The NHL action continues this Saturday, February 18th, with a whopping 13 match-ups on the schedule. Thanks to the influx of games, there are plenty of exciting NHL player props to take advantage of. Keep reading to unearth my recommended picks for Saturday’s games.

William Nylander – Over 1.5 Points (+165)

Canadiens vs. Maple Leafs Predictions

The Toronto Maples Leafs will be confident of dispatching the Montreal Canadiens at Scotiabank Arena on Saturday, as the Canadiens find themselves rock bottom of the Atlantic Division – six places below the Maple Leafs.

With that in mind, Toronto’s William Nylander looks destined to enjoy plenty of success this weekend. Having racked up five points across his previous two appearances, Nylander shouldn’t struggle to grab over 1.5 points against lowly Montreal.

Andrei Svechnikov – Over 0.5 Points (-145)

Capitals vs. Hurricanes Predictions

Thanks to a run of nine wins in 10 games, the Carolina Hurricanes sit at the summit of the Metropolitan Division. At the opposite end of the standings, the Washington Capitals find themselves third from bottom following three successive losses.

Carolina’s Andrei Svechnikov bagged three points during his team’s 6-2 victory over Montreal last time out. The Russian winger now has registered 11 points in his past 10 outings, so I’m confident that he will add to his tally against the struggling Capitals.

Mika Zibanejad – Over 2.5 Shots on Goal (-140)

Rangers vs. Flames Predictions

When the New York Rangers faced the Calgary Flames earlier this month, Mika Zibanejad produced an outstanding individual performance, chalking up three points and eight shots on goal. On Saturday, the Rangers will lock horns with the Flames once again.

Zibanejad has achieved 3+ shots on goal in seven of his previous 10 appearances, helping the Rangers rack up a seven-game winning streak in the process. Since the Flames have lost each of their last two outings, I can see Zibanejad running riot this weekend.

Dylan Larkin – Over 0.5 Assists (+115)

Red Wings vs. Kraken Predictions

Not only have the Detroit Red Wings won each of their last five games, but they have also won seven of their previous nine. For that reason, the Red Wings will fancy their chances of frustrating the Seattle Kraken, who have struggled for consistency in recent weeks.

Detroit’s Dylan Larkin has assisted in six of his past nine appearances and even managed to notch three assists against Calgary last time out. Larkin is priced at +115 to register an assist on Saturday, so I recommend jumping on that price.

Adrian Kempe – Over 0.5 Points (-165)

Coyotes vs. Kings Predictions

Adrian Kempe has been racking up points for fun of late. Indeed, the Los Angeles Kings winger has recorded 13 points across his previous nine outings, with four points coming against the Pittsburgh Penguins last weekend.

Having won each of their last three games, the Kings host the Arizona Coyotes on Saturday. The Kings occupy second place in the Pacific Division, while the Coyotes find themselves second from bottom in the Central Division, so Kempe should continue his scoring streak this weekend.
